mirror of
https://github.com/MCSManager/MCSManager.git
synced 2024-11-27 06:59:54 +08:00
新增 新建 Docker 镜像界面与命令工具
This commit is contained in:
parent
18850fa95c
commit
66b467be45
@ -1,6 +1,15 @@
|
||||
//工具箱
|
||||
|
||||
const os = require("os");
|
||||
const childProcess = require('child_process');
|
||||
|
||||
module.exports.startProcess = (command, parList, ProcessConfigs, callback) => {
|
||||
let process =
|
||||
childProcess.spawn(command, parList, ProcessConfigs);
|
||||
process.on('exit', (code) => {
|
||||
callback('exit', code);
|
||||
});
|
||||
}
|
||||
|
||||
module.exports.getMineTime = () => {
|
||||
var date = new Date();
|
||||
|
40
public/template/component/new_docker_image.html
Normal file
40
public/template/component/new_docker_image.html
Normal file
@ -0,0 +1,40 @@
|
||||
<div id='NewDockerImage' class="OneContainer">
|
||||
<div class="col-md-12 ">
|
||||
<div class="Panel">
|
||||
<div class="PanelTitle">计划任务项目表达式</div>
|
||||
<div class="PanelBody">
|
||||
<div class="row">
|
||||
<div class="col-md-12">
|
||||
<p>创建新的 Docker 镜像</p>
|
||||
<small>您不需要具备 Docker 专业知识,最简单的方法是,您只需要填写一个名字即可。
|
||||
<br>其他选项请给有需求与具备相关知识的人员填写。
|
||||
</small>
|
||||
<p>DockerFile 文件:</p>
|
||||
<textarea rows="3" cols="20">
|
||||
|
||||
</textarea>
|
||||
|
||||
<p>
|
||||
确认无误之后,单击新建镜像按钮,但是这需要一定时间的等待,创建完成后 MCSM 会通知您。
|
||||
</p>
|
||||
<button class="btn btn-success" v-on:click="ok()">
|
||||
保存 Docker 配置
|
||||
</button>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
|
||||
<script>
|
||||
MI.rListener('onload', function () {
|
||||
|
||||
});
|
||||
|
||||
MI.rListener('onend', function () {
|
||||
|
||||
});
|
||||
</script>
|
Loading…
Reference in New Issue
Block a user